Rechallenge with trastuzumab emtansine of patient with metastatic colorectal cancer progressing after treatment with lapatinib and trastuzumab

Open-label, phase ii study of trastuzumab emtansine in patients with HER2-positive metastatic colorectal cancer progressing after trastuzumab and lapatinib: (HER2 Amplification for Colo-rectaL cancer Enhanced Stratification ¿ REchallenge with her2 Selective Cytotoxic Uptake of Emtansine). Main Objective: Define the efficacy of trastuzumab-emtansine in HER2 amplified metastatic CRC patients with advanced disease refractory to chemotherapy, anti EGFR monoclonals, antiangiogenics and lapatinib plus trastuzumab combination (i.e. patients progressing within the HERACLES trial). ;Secondary Objective: Define the safety profile of T-DM1 in patients pre-treated with trastuzumab-lapatinib. Define the response duration to T-DM1 Define the time to progression to T-DM1;Primary end point(s): Objective Response Rate according to RECIST 1.1 criteria;Timepoint(s) of evaluation of this end point: first assessment after 6 weeks, then every 9 weeks
